Factors to Consider When Choosing the Size
Several factors influence the ideal size for your X-raypad Aqua Control+. These include your desk space, mouse movement style, and personal comfort preferences. Consider the following:
- Desk Space: Measure your desk to ensure the mouse pad fits comfortably without overcrowding your workspace.
- Mouse Movement: If you prefer large sweeping motions, a larger pad provides more room. For precise, smaller movements, a smaller pad may suffice.
- Comfort: Longer gaming sessions benefit from a size that allows natural arm movement without strain.
Advantages of Different Sizes
Each size offers unique benefits:
Small Size
The small size is ideal for limited desk space and gamers who prefer precise, controlled mouse movements. It is portable and easy to store.
Medium Size
The medium size strikes a balance between space and control. It provides ample room for most gaming styles and is suitable for average desk sizes.
Large Size
The large size offers maximum space for sweeping movements, making it perfect for FPS and MOBA gamers who require extensive mouse mobility. It also adds comfort for long gaming sessions.
